by John R. Gregg (Author)

Sex, The Illustrated History: Volume Three, continues a courageous exploration of sexual customs and conflicts into the modern world. This work explores the fight for sexual freedom in a world of often repressed sexuality. The conflict with the Church and its control of sexuality and law, has stood as a barrier against freedom of human sexuality. The focus of this work is primarily the European and American theater, as they strive to rise above the ancient precepts that have girdled sexuality. The fight was a long and hard fought one; prejudice and prudery, and claims of morality and law, standing rigidly against a new rationalism beginning in the reformation. The book explores in depth; historical and contemporary worldwide slavery, forced marriage, child brides, abuses of the Catholic Church and sexual trafficking. Also explored are the history of homosexual movements, bisexuality, and the larger LGBT+ movements.
